Problems Using AOL With Windows Me

If you try to use AOL software with Windows Me, you may encounter a number of errors:

  • When you try to connect to AOL for the first time, you may receive one of the following error messages during step 6, Connecting to America Online:
    • The access company failed to respond properly
    • The access company failed to respond properly (6 A)
    • The access network failed to properly respond
    • The access network failed to properly respond (6 A)
    Note that your second dial-up attempt does work.

  • After you use AOL and you attempt to shut down your computer, your computer does not completely shut down. You may need to reset your computer, however, the main power button may not work.

According to AOL, the current workaround for this behavior is to install AOL version 6.
